Josh Koscheck To Co-Headline UFC 106

Welterweight Josh Koscheck has announced via Twitter that he’ll be co-headlining UFC 106 on November 21 in Las Vegas.

An opponent has not yet been announced for the bout, a late-addition to bolster the card currently headlined by Tito Ortiz vs. Forrest Griffin after losing Brock Lesnar vs. Shane Carwin, its original main event, on Monday. One potential opponent, Matt Hughes, has reportedly turned down the short-notice matchup, with Anthony Johnson now the speculated front-runner.

UFC 104 Medical Suspensions: Machida Sidelined 60 Days; Barry Out Up To Six Months

UFC 104 winners Lyoto Machida and Patrick Barry were among eight fighters from Saturday’s event in Los Angeles who were issued medical suspensions by the California State Athletic Commission on Tuesday.

Machida, the UFC’s light heavyweight champ who won a controversial decision over Mauricio “Shogun” Rua in the UFC 104 headliner, was suspended for 60 days for a lip laceration, potentially delaying an immediate rematch with Rua that was reportedly being planned for UFC 108 on January 2.

UFC 104 Fighter Salaries: Headliners Machida and Rua Top Payroll

UFC light heavyweight champ Lyoto Machida and challenger Mauricio “Shogun” Rua, who headlined Saturday’s UFC 104 event in Los Angeles, topped the pay-per-view event’s disclosed $922,000 fighter payroll, according to figures released Tuesday by the California State Athletic Commission.

Machida earned an event-high $200,000 for his controversial main event win over Rua, while “Shogun” received $155,000 for his efforts. Other top earners included Joe Stevenson ($94,000), Cain Velasquez ($70,000), and Chael Sonnen ($54,000).

Barry, Hardonk, and Struve Win UFC 104 “Fight Night” Bonuses

Patrick Barry scored an extra $120,000 on Saturday, earning two $60,000 “Fight Night” bonuses for his second-round knockout of Antoni Hardonk at “UFC 104: Machida vs. Shogun” at the Staples Center in Los Angeles. Hardonk and Stefan Struve also picked up $60,000 bonuses for their showings at last night’s pay-per-view event.

Lyoto Machida, “Shogun” Rua Agree to Immediate Rematch

UFC light heavyweight champ Lyoto Machida and Mauricio “Shogun” Rua have agreed to an immediate rematch following Machida’s controversial decision win over Rua on Saturday in the main event of UFC 104.

“I thought “Shogun” won the fight. I think there will be a rematch.” said UFC President Dana White at the post-fight press conference. “I talked to both of them and they both agreed to a rematch.”

UFC 104 Results: Machida Retains Title With Controversial Win Over “Shogun,” Velasquez Dominates Rothwell

The “Machida Era” was extended in controversial fashion on Saturday, as light heavyweight champ Lyoto Machida was awarded a questionable unanimous decision win over Mauricio “Shogun” Rua in the main event of UFC 104 at the Staples Center in Los Angeles.

Cain Velasquez dominated Ben Rothwell in the UFC 104 co-headliner, while Gleison Tibau, Joe Stevenson, and Anthony Johnson also earned main card wins.

Anthony Johnson Talks Missing Weight for UFC 104, Will Eventually Move to Middleweight

Welterweight Anthony Johnson, who weighed in 6 pounds over the 170 pound division limit on Friday for tonight’s UFC 104 event, talks to Heavy.com about missing weight and a future move up to middleweight.

“I was in the sauna for an hour and I lost three or four pounds right off the bat. I knew it was coming off. That’s why I said that if I had another hour or two, I would have been able to make it. I got out of the sauna, and I think I was out too long because my sweating stopped, and when I got back in the sauna I couldn’t get anything else off. That’s what broke me.”

UFC 104 Weigh-In Results: Machida and Shogun Set for Headliner; Johnson, Neer, and Tibau Miss Weight

All twenty-two fighters who will be in action at Saturday’s UFC 104 event at the Staples Center in Los Angeles hit the scales today to weigh in for their bouts. Light heavyweight champ Lyoto Machida (202.5) and challenger Mauricio “Shogun” Rua (204.5) successfully made weight for the UFC 104 main event, as did co-headliners Cain Velasquez (238) and Ben Rothwell (265).

Anthony Johnson, Josh Neer, and Gleison Tibau were the only fighters who failed to make weight, but their fights will go on as scheduled.
